Dr. Carl Baum, MD, FAAP, FACMT



Dr. Carl Baum ​is Professor of Pediatrics and of Emergency Medicine at the Yale School of Medicine, where he serves as Attending Physician in the Pediatric Emergency Department. He is Director of the Yale Regional Lead Treatment Center, and is a toxicology consultant for the Connecticut Poison Control Center.

Nationally, he is a member of the Executive Committee of the American Academy of Pediatrics’ Council on Children and Disasters. He is an appointee of the American Board of Pediatrics’ Medical Toxicology Subboard. In addition, he is the medical director for the National Program Office of the federally funded Pediatric Environmental Health Specialty Unit (PEHSU) program.
